Cobblestone Installation in Denver, CO
Cobblestone installation services involve laying natural or manufactured stone to create durable, attractive surfaces on residential properties. This service is commonly used for driveways, walkways, patios, and landscaping features, providing a timeless aesthetic that enhances curb appeal.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of cobblestones available, the installation process, and the maintenance required to keep the surface looking its best over time.
Before requesting cobblestone installation, homeowners often seek information about the project’s scope, including the size and layout of the area, as well as the selection of stone materials that complement their property’s style. It’s also important to consider proper preparation of the underlying surface, drainage considerations, and the overall durability of the cobblestones for long-term use. Clear understanding of these factors helps ensure the finished installation meets expectations and withstands local weather conditions.

Cobblestone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for cobblestone installation? Cobblestone is ideal for driveways, walkways, patios, and decorative landscaping features around properties in Denver and nearby areas.
How durable is cobblestone for outdoor surfaces? Cobblestone is known for its strength and long-lasting performance, making it suitable for high-traffic areas and outdoor use.
What should property owners consider before installing cobblestones? It's important to evaluate the existing terrain, drainage needs, and the overall aesthetic to ensure proper installation and longevity.
Can cobblestones be used in combination with other paving materials? Yes, cobblestones can complement other surfaces like concrete or asphalt for a customized and functional outdoor space.
